Installation Guide for CS 1.6 Graffiti

Start by backing up your cstrike folder. Extract the graffiti files—primarily the sprite sheet and any associated .res files—directly into the root directory. For optimal integration, edit your autoexec.cfg to preload the sprite: add 'precache_user "sprites/godsent_logo.spr"'. Test in a local server by joining and using the spray menu (default bind: 'y'). If you're running bots, ensure .nav files on maps like de_cbble don't interfere with placement visibility.
